国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> JavaScript > 正文

javascript解析json實例詳解

2019-11-20 13:57:37
字體:
來源:轉載
供稿:網友

本文實例講述了javascript解析json的方法。分享給大家供大家參考。具體方法如下:

下載json庫
http://www.json.org/json-zh.html自己找javascript的
或者直接去下面的
https://github.com/douglascrockford/JSON-js
 
php生成json格式

使用頁面

復制代碼 代碼如下:
<script src="scripts/json.js"></script> 
alert(data.toJSONString());

 
如果返回false說明沒數據
 
js 代碼:
復制代碼 代碼如下:
functionshowJSON() {  
   varuser =  
     {  
       "username":"tom",  
       "age":20,  
        "info": {"tel":"123456","cellphone":"98765"},  
      "address":  
       [  
                {"city":"shanghai","postcode":"201203"},  
                 {"city":"suzhou","postcode":"200000"}  
             ]  
     }  
      
     alert(user.username);  
     alert(user.age);  
     alert(user.info.cellphone);  
     alert(user.address[0].city);  
     alert(user.address[0].postcode);  
}

修改
復制代碼 代碼如下:
user.username ="jerry";

可以使用eval來轉換JSON字符到Object
復制代碼 代碼如下:
functionmyEval() {  
    varstr = '{"name":"Violet","occupation":"character"}';  
    varbj = eval('(' + str + ')');  
     alert(obj.toJSONString());  
}

 
或者使用parseJSON()方法
復制代碼 代碼如下:
functionmyEval() {  
    varstr = '{"name":"Violet","occupation":"character"}';  
    varbj = str.parseJSON();  
     alert(obj.toJSONString());  
}

希望本文所述對大家的javascript程序設計有所幫助。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 乐清市| 梨树县| 金寨县| 鹤峰县| 永定县| 外汇| 凤冈县| 鹤山市| 长丰县| 定日县| 红河县| 高雄市| 成安县| 准格尔旗| 上栗县| 寿宁县| 镶黄旗| 开鲁县| 太白县| 略阳县| 原平市| 苗栗市| 北流市| 锡林浩特市| 郁南县| 固安县| 广元市| 安国市| 扎赉特旗| 嘉义县| 榆中县| 都匀市| 五台县| 贞丰县| 察雅县| 宜昌市| 德令哈市| 宜黄县| 资源县| 苍溪县| 鹤峰县|